The New York Daily News spoke with John Schwarzlose, president and CEO of the Betty Ford Center, about the behavior of Britney Spears and Lindsay Lohan in rehab, where Britney couldn’t stay for more than a day and Lindsay seemed to spend more time outside Wonderland – including several nightclub visits – than getting help. “It trivializes something that is very, very important,” Schwarzlose remarked. “I think of all the people out there who are trying to make the decision to finally seek help for their problems. They’re watching what’s going on, seeing people bounce in and out, or the people trying to exonerate themselves.” He added, “I think the people that suffer are the men and women that today are thinking, ‘Am I finally ready to seek help?’ I worry that this will convince them not to.”
